Thank you! So my study material ranged from the NCEES practice exam booklet, PrepFE, practice problems from ENGÉNIEER, YouTube videos from Gregory Michaelson and FE practice exams. I would say make sure you have a well grasp of your calculator. My first time around the calculator I used wasn’t the best, couldn’t use it to my advantage and didn’t know it well enough. On top if you aren’t 100% confident in all subjects - that’s TOTALLY okay - I wasn’t. Try to review every subject when studying to know what problems are expected to come and their format. But strengthen the ones you feel very confident in, those are your money makers. Remember to answer every question. My timeline wasn’t the greatest - as you can see took my about 3yrs to complete bc I would get discouraged every time. But I can say about 2-1.5months out I was studying about 2hrs for 3/4times a week

Hi all! I just wanted to come on here and say never give up - keep on studying! I graduated from college over 2 years ago, had taken the exam twice with failing both times. This third time around I learned how to use my calculator (HUGE life saver), worked on subjects that I needed more practice in and used all resources available to me. I’m not going to lie this exam is daunting and studying isn’t any easier especially with a full time work and life events. Remember everyone has their own timeline and you shouldn’t compare yourself to others it’ll only add more pressure. But keep on pushing and trust me, we’ll all get there. Thank you to everyone!!
